用X射线荧光光谱法测定试样的主要成分时,主要是用数学校正法来校正基体成分对分析结果的影响,然而用数学校正法来分析试样中的低、微量元素是很困难的.分析试样中的低、微量元素,多数作者是采用散射内标法或加人内标法来校正基体效应.用散射内标法测定试样中的低、微量元素时,背景强度的变化往往影响分析结果的精确度,特别是分析元素靠近检出限时,分析元素能否检出以及测定结果的精确度如何,主要取决于背景强度的大小及背景测定的精确度. 相似文献

在对比已有相关分析方法的基础上,建立了粉末压片-波长色散X射线荧光光谱法测定地球化学样品中氯元素的分析方法.采用岩石、沉积物和土壤等78种国家一级地球化学标准物质作为校准系列建立校准曲线;利用经验系数法进行基体效应校正,利用含量校正法进行谱线重叠干扰校正;总结了地球化学样品中氯元素测定值随测定次数的变化规律及原因.结果表明:氯的检出限为7.95μg/g;分析3种国家一级地球化学标准物质12次,得到测定值的相对标准偏差均小于10%;采用国家一级地球化学标准物质验证方法准确度,测定值与标准物质认定值相吻合,测定平均值与标准物质认定值的对数差值的绝对值(?lgω)均小于或等于0.02,满足多目标区域地球化学调查规范的要求. 相似文献

原子荧光光谱法直接测定载金炭样品中的砷 总被引:1,自引:0,他引:1
建立了原子荧光光谱法直接测定载金炭样品中砷的分析方法。采用硝酸溶样,原子荧光光谱法直接测定载金炭样品中的砷。该方法具有准确度高、流程短、精密度好、速度快等优点。比对试验结果表明,该方法测定结果与全谱直读ICP法结果一致。 相似文献

高铝稀土锌合金的光电直读光谱分析 总被引:1,自引:1,他引:0
用光电直读光谱法分析高铝稀土锌合金中合金元素和杂质元素的含量,确定了被测元素的光谱分析线、最佳分析条件、分析样品制备要求、校准曲线的拟合情况。方法制样简单,无污染,各元素相对标准偏差(RSD,n=11)≤6.67%,与国标方法对照,结果相符。 相似文献

较低稀释比熔融制样X射线荧光光谱法分析铬铁矿 总被引:3,自引:3,他引:0
铬铁矿属难熔矿物,目前对铬铁矿的分析以化学分析为主,方法成熟,但操作麻烦且步骤繁琐;而应用X射线荧光光谱法进行分析测定,一般都采用较高稀释比熔融制样,不利于低含量元素的测定。本文选用四硼酸锂+偏硼酸锂作为混合熔剂,与样品以20:1的稀释比熔融制样,利用波长色散X射线荧光光谱测定铬铁矿中多种元素(Cr、Si、Al、TFe、Mg、Ca、Mn)的方法。采用多种铬铁矿标准物质和人工配制标准物质制作工作曲线,理论α系数及康普顿散射内标法校正元素间的吸收-增强效应,方法精密度(RSD,n=10)为0.2%~5.3%。方法检出限低,如锰元素的检出限可低至60 μg/g;镁元素的检出限为225 μg/g,比文献采用高稀释比XRF测定的方法检出限(250 μg/g)要低。本方法通过选择有效的熔剂和较低的稀释比解决了铬铁矿的制样问题,熔剂的用量减少,称样量增加,提高了低含量元素分析的准确度,相应地降低了分析成本。 相似文献

将X射线荧光光谱法应用于硅灰石中SiO2、CaO、Al2O3、Fe2O3、P2O5、MgO、K2O、TiO2、MnO的同时快速测定。试样和混合熔剂的质量比为1:10,在此稀释比时试样在熔剂中的分散度(浓度)适当,可适应各个组分的测定。熔融法分解试样有效地消除了试样的粒度效应和矿物效应。采用理论α系数校正法克服了基体吸收及增强效应。用国家标准物质和样品验证了方法的精密度和准确度,其结果与化学分析值相符。 相似文献

Pant-y-ffynnon Quarry in South Wales yielded a rich cache of fossils in the early 1950s, including articulated specimens of new species (the small sauropodomorph dinosaur Pantydraco caducus and the crocodylomorph Terrestrisuchus gracilis), but no substantial study of the wider fauna of the Pant-y-ffynnon fissure systems has been published. Here, our overview of existing specimens, a few described but mostly undescribed, as well as freshly processed material, provides a comprehensive picture of the Pant-y-ffynnon palaeo-island of the Late Triassic. This was an island with a relatively impoverished fauna dominated by small clevosaurs (rhynchocephalians), including a new species, Clevosaurus cambrica, described here from a partially articulated specimen and isolated bones. The new species has a dental morphology that is intermediate between the Late Triassic Clevosaurus hudsoni, from Cromhall Quarry to the east, and the younger C. convallis from Pant Quarry to the west, suggesting adaptive radiation of clevosaurs in the palaeo-archipelago. The larger reptiles on the palaeo-island do not exceed 1.5?m in length, including a small carnivorous crocodylomorph, Terrestrisuchus, and a possible example of insular dwarfism in the basal dinosaur Pantydraco. 相似文献

The effect of water on accessory phase solubility in subaluminous and peralkaline granitic melts 总被引:4,自引:0,他引:4
The solubilities of columbite, tantalite, wolframite, rutile, zircon and hafnon were determined as a function of the water contents in peralkaline and subaluminous granite melts. All experiments were conducted at 1035 °C and 2 kbar and the water contents of the melts ranged from nominally dry to approximately 6 wt.% H2O. Accessory phase solubilities are not affected by the water content of the peralkaline melt. By contrast, solubilities are affected by the water content of the subaluminous melt, where the solubilities of all the accessory phases examined increase with the water content of the melt, up to 2 wt.% H2O. At higher water contents, solubilities are nearly constant. It can be concluded that water is not an important control of accessory phase solubility, although the water content will affect diffusivities of components in the melt, thus whether or not accessory phases will be present as restite material. The solubility behaviour in the subaluminous and peralkaline melts supports previous spectroscopic studies, which have observed differences in the coordination of high field strength elements in dry vs. wet subaluminous granitic glasses, but not for peralkaline granitic glasses. Lastly, the fact that wolframite solubility increases with increasing water content in the subaluminous melt suggests that tungsten dissolved as a hexavalent species. 相似文献

Calcite samples were extracted both from the rock matrix and the superficial coating of a karstified fault plane of an underground quarry, located in the eastern border of the Paris basin. The karstification is dated as Quaternary. Analysis of mechanical calcite twinning reveals that only the calcite matrix has also undergone a compression trending WNW that can be attributed to the Mio-Pliocene alpine collision. Both coating and matrix have undergone a strike-slip regime with σ1 roughly trending north–south, that could correspond to the regional present-day state of stress, a strike-slip compression rather trending NNW, modified by local phenomena.
